Even a short break from alcohol can significantly improve your health, so celebrate those early wins. An alcohol-free lifestyle, sometimes called teetotalism, simply means not drinking alcohol. People choose this path for all sorts of reasons, from wanting to improve their physical and mental well-being to aligning with their personal values. It's a decision based on what feels right for each individual.

One of the biggest hurdles to socializing without alcohol can be peer pressure. It's natural to feel some anxiety about how friends and family will react to your decision. Before heading to a social event, think about how you'll respond if someone questions your choice.

While the liver’s full return to perfect health may take longer, pausing alcohol stops ethanol metabolism, reduces oxidative damage, and reduces liver fat alcohol free lifestyle accumulation over time. Your liver is an amazing organ that can start healing from alcohol damage within days.

Tracking your progress is a powerful way to stay motivated because it makes your efforts tangible. Using tools to monitor your drink-free days, the money you’ve saved, or improvements in your mood can provide a steady stream of positive reinforcement. For instance, the average cost of a gym membership is $60 per month, while a monthly subscription to a meditation app is around $15. With the $500 saved from three months of sobriety, you could fund a year’s worth of fitness and mental wellness tools, effectively reinvesting in your health. Alternatively, this money could cover a weekend getaway or a significant portion of a professional certification course. The point is, the financial freedom gained from cutting out alcohol isn’t just about the dollars saved—it’s about the opportunities those dollars can unlock.
